Factors to Consider When Choosing Air Fryer For Large Families
Choosing the right air fryer for large families involves balancing capacity, versatility, and ease of use. Larger models offer the advantage of cooking more food at once, but can take up significant counter space. Multi-function units provide additional cooking options, reducing the need for multiple appliances, but often come with more complex controls and larger footprints. I’ll guide you through key considerations to help you select the best fit based on your kitchen size, cooking habits, and budget.Capacity and Size
For large families, capacity is paramount. Aim for at least 8 quarts, with 12 quarts or more ideal if you frequently cook for many people at once. Keep in mind that bigger models tend to be bulkier, requiring more counter space, so measure your kitchen beforehand. Dual-zone or multi-function appliances often add to the size but can save space in the long run by replacing multiple devices.
Versatility and Functions
Multi-function appliances like toaster ovens with air frying or 5-in-1 models cover a range of cooking needs, reducing clutter and cost. However, they may have complex controls and longer cooking times. Simpler models focused solely on air frying tend to be easier to operate, which is ideal if you prioritize quick, straightforward cooking with minimal fuss.
Ease of Cleaning and Use
Dishwasher-safe parts and intuitive controls can make daily use less of a chore. Look for models with nonstick coatings and straightforward interfaces. Complex control panels might provide more options but can also be confusing for everyday use, especially for busy households.
Price and Value
While larger and multi-function models generally cost more, they can replace several appliances, offering better value in the long run. Balance your budget with the features you truly need. Sometimes, a slightly smaller but easier-to-use unit can serve large families just as well without the added complexity and cost.
Frequently Asked Questions
What size air fryer is best for a large family?
For large families, an air fryer with at least 8 quarts of capacity is recommended, with 12 quarts or more being ideal. Larger sizes allow you to cook multiple servings at once, reducing overall meal prep time. Keep in mind that bigger units may require more counter space and can be heavier to handle.
Are multi-function air fryers worth the extra cost?
Multi-function air fryers can replace several kitchen appliances, providing greater flexibility and saving space. They are particularly useful if you enjoy baking, roasting, or dehydrating alongside air frying. However, they often come with more complex controls and larger sizes, which might be overwhelming for some users. Consider your cooking habits and kitchen space before choosing a multi-purpose model.
How important is ease of cleaning in an air fryer for large families?
Ease of cleaning is vital for large families that cook frequently. Models with dishwasher-safe parts, nonstick coatings, and simple designs reduce the time and effort needed to keep the appliance hygienic. This can make daily meal prep less stressful and more enjoyable.
Can I use a smaller air fryer for large family meals?
While smaller air fryers can still prepare meals for large families, they often require cooking in multiple batches, which increases prep and cooking time. For efficiency, a larger capacity unit is generally better suited to meet the demands of big households, especially during busy mealtimes.
Is energy consumption a concern with large air fryers?
Yes, larger and more powerful models tend to use more electricity, especially those with high wattage like 1700W or more. If energy use is a concern, look for models with efficient heating technology or consider how often you’ll use the appliance to balance convenience with cost. Smaller, more efficient models may be more suitable for occasional large meals if energy savings are a priority.
